The single biggest reason students underperform at A Level Geography isn’t content knowledge, it’s essay structure. A student who understands coastal erosion in detail can still score a D on a 20-mark question if their argument lacks a clear evaluative thread, fails to reference competing geographical perspectives, or doesn’t reach a substantiated conclusion. Our private A Level geography tutors teach that essay architecture explicitly, drilling it on real past paper questions, marking it against the AQA and Edexcel mark schemes, and embedding it until top-band writing becomes the default rather than the exception.
